CVE-2025-9615: Improper Preservation of Permissions in Red Hat Red Hat Enterprise Linux 10

Description

A flaw was found in NetworkManager. The NetworkManager package allows access to files that may belong to other users. NetworkManager allows non-root users to configure the system's network. The daemon runs with root privileges and can access files owned by users different from the one who added the connection.

Technical Analysis

CVE-2025-9615 identifies a security flaw in the NetworkManager component of Red Hat Enterprise Linux 10. NetworkManager is responsible for managing network connections and allows non-root users to configure network settings. The vulnerability arises because the NetworkManager daemon, which runs with root privileges, improperly preserves file permissions when accessing configuration files. This flaw enables the daemon to access files owned by users other than the one who created the network connection, potentially exposing sensitive user data to unauthorized parties. The issue does not allow modification of files or disruption of services but compromises confidentiality by unauthorized read access. Exploitation requires local access with limited privileges (PR:L) but no user interaction (UI:N). The vulnerability has a CVSS 3.0 base score of 3.3, reflecting low severity due to limited impact and the need for local access. No known exploits have been reported in the wild, and no patches or mitigations were linked at the time of reporting. This vulnerability is particularly relevant in multi-user environments where users share systems and network configurations are managed via NetworkManager. The flaw highlights the importance of strict permission handling in privileged daemons to prevent unauthorized data exposure.

Potential Impact

The primary impact of CVE-2025-9615 is a confidentiality breach where unauthorized local users can access files belonging to other users through NetworkManager's privileged daemon. While the vulnerability does not affect data integrity or system availability, the exposure of sensitive files can lead to privacy violations, leakage of credentials, or other sensitive information. In multi-user systems, this could facilitate lateral movement or privilege escalation attempts by revealing information useful for further attacks. The requirement for local access limits the scope to insiders or attackers who have already compromised a low-privilege account. Organizations relying on Red Hat Enterprise Linux 10 in shared or multi-tenant environments, such as enterprise servers, cloud platforms, or development systems, are most at risk. The absence of known exploits reduces immediate threat but does not eliminate the risk of future exploitation once details become widely known. Overall, the impact is low but non-negligible in sensitive environments.

Mitigation Recommendations

To mitigate CVE-2025-9615, organizations should: 1) Monitor Red Hat advisories closely and apply official patches or updates for NetworkManager as soon as they are released. 2) Restrict local user access to systems running RHEL 10, especially limiting the number of users with network configuration privileges. 3) Implement strict access controls and file permission audits on NetworkManager configuration directories and files to detect unauthorized access. 4) Use mandatory access control systems like SELinux to enforce fine-grained policies restricting NetworkManager daemon file access. 5) Consider isolating critical systems or using containerization to limit the impact of local privilege misuse. 6) Educate system administrators and users about the risks of local access vulnerabilities and enforce strong user account management. 7) Regularly review logs for unusual NetworkManager activity that could indicate exploitation attempts.
